Historical Context and Industry Evolution
Traditional online casino games—such as roulette, blackjack, and slots—dominated the industry for years, relying on well-understood odds and established regulatory frameworks. However, with advances in blockchain technology and the proliferation of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um, a new class of gambling products has emerged: crypto-based wagering platforms offering innovative game mechanics rooted in transparency and decentralization.
Crash games, in particular, gained popularity as simple yet addictive online games where players bet on a multiplier that increases exponentially until it “crashes.” These games are often built on Provably Fair algorithms, ensuring transparency, and enable real-time gambling using cryptocurrencies without the traditional institutional overhead.
The Mechanics and Appeal of Crash Games
| Feature | Description | Impact on Players |
|---|---|---|
| Rapid Play Cycles | Gamers place bets and observe outcomes within seconds, heightening excitement and engagement. | Increases impulse betting and potential losses, yet appeals to thrill-seekers. |
| Multipliers and Risk | The multiplier growth is unpredictable, with the game ending abruptly once it crashes. | Encourages strategic risk-taking and can lead to significant monetary gains or losses. |
| Cryptocurrency Integration | Transactions are fast, borderless, and anonymous, appealing to a global audience. | Reduces barriers to entry, but raises concerns over regulatory oversight and player safety. |
Regulatory Challenges and Industry Credibility
As these platforms proliferate, regulators face increasing difficulty in keeping pace with technological ingenuity. The decentralized nature of cryptocurrency-based crash games often operates in jurisdictions with lax or evolving regulations, complicating enforcement efforts.
Nevertheless, industry leaders and consumer protection advocates emphasize the importance of transparency features such as Provably Fair algorithms, which bolster trust. The inclusion of licensed operators and adherence to responsible gambling practices remain critical to maintain credibility and ensure ethical standards within this niche.
